How to Choose the Best Bookshelves for Small Spaces Without Losing Wall Integrity
The first thing I do when a client asks me to add book storage to a studio or one-bedroom is locate the studs with an electronic stud finder—not the magnetic kind that only finds nails, but a proper sensor that detects density changes behind drywall. In 2019 a Manhattan client wanted open shelving for her first-edition collection positioned on her west-facing wall, and when I mapped the studs I discovered they were spaced 24 inches on center instead of the standard 16 inches, which meant any floating shelf system would need custom bracket placement or we'd be anchoring into drywall that couldn't support more than 10 pounds per anchor point. We ended up installing a freestanding tree bookshelf instead, which required zero wall penetration and gave her the flexibility to move it when she repainted the following year. The lesson is that stud location dictates your design options more than any aesthetic preference, and if you're in a pre-war building with lath-and-plaster walls, you may find studs are irregular or missing entirely in sections where previous owners ran electrical conduit.
The second detail I check is weight capacity per shelf, and I've learned to ignore the manufacturer's listed rating and calculate it myself based on the shelf material and span. A 36-inch shelf made from half-inch particle board will sag under 30 pounds even if the bracket claims it can hold 50, because particle board compresses over time and the sag becomes permanent once the fibers crush. I specify Baltic birch plywood for any shelf longer than 24 inches, and I insist on brackets spaced no more than 16 inches apart if the client plans to load the shelf with hardcovers. In 2016 I designed a window seat with storage in a Cos Cob colonial, and the contractor built it with big-box plywood instead of the Baltic birch I'd specified—the doors warped within the first humid summer and we had to rebuild the entire unit in 2017 using the correct material. The difference in cost was maybe forty dollars, but the difference in performance was the gap between furniture that lasts a decade and furniture that fails before the paint dries.
The third consideration is clearance behind and around the unit, which matters more in small spaces because every wasted inch shows. Corner bookshelves look efficient in catalog photos, but in practice they rarely sit flush against both walls unless you're in new construction with perfectly square corners and thin baseboards. I've measured pre-war apartments in Boston and Manhattan where corner units left a 4-inch gap behind them because the baseboard projected 2 inches from the wall and the corner itself was out of square by another inch—suddenly your space-saving design is wasting 16 square inches of floor area and collecting dust in a zone you can't reach without moving the entire unit. A ladder-style bookshelf or a narrow tree design that sits parallel to one wall eliminates that problem entirely, and if you choose an open-back design, it won't block the radiator or the one electrical outlet you need for your reading lamp. Five Details That Separate Space-Saving Storage from Structural Disasters
The thing nobody mentions about weight distribution on vertical shelving
When you're evaluating tree-style or ladder bookshelves, the critical detail is how the weight transfers from the top shelves down to the base—if the design relies on a single central post or a narrow footprint, loading the upper tiers with hardcovers will make the entire unit top-heavy and prone to tipping. I specify units with a base spread of at least 18 inches for any bookshelf taller than 5 feet, and I insist on a triangular or T-shaped footprint rather than a simple rectangular base because the geometry resists tipping when the top shelves are fully loaded. In a Manhattan studio I designed in 2026, the client wanted a 7-tier tree bookshelf positioned in a corner, and I had her anchor the top shelf to the wall with a single L-bracket even though the unit was freestanding—that one bracket prevented the whole thing from tipping forward when her toddler grabbed the second shelf to pull himself up. The bracket was invisible behind the books and took five minutes to install, but it was the difference between safe storage and a furniture-tipping hazard.
The second part of weight distribution is understanding how the shelves attach to the vertical supports. Shelves that slide into grooves or rest on pegs will shift over time as the wood expands and contracts with humidity, and if the groove is shallow—less than half an inch—the shelf can work its way loose and tilt forward. I've seen this happen with budget ladder shelves where the shelves are held by quarter-inch pegs drilled into the side rails; after six months of use, the pegs loosen and the shelves develop a forward tilt that makes books slide off the front edge. I prefer designs where the shelves are screwed or bolted to the uprights, or where the attachment uses a full dado joint that locks the shelf in place mechanically rather than relying on friction. It's a detail you can't see in a product photo, but if you look at the assembly instructions or examine the unit in person, you'll know within thirty seconds whether the shelf attachment will hold up or fail.
The third consideration is the shelf depth relative to the height of the books you own. Standard hardcovers are 9 to 10 inches tall, and they need a shelf depth of at least 8 inches to sit upright without tipping forward—but if the shelf is deeper than 10 inches, you'll waste space behind the books that you can't use for anything else. I specify 8 to 9 inch shelf depth for fiction and general nonfiction, and I go to 10 or 11 inches only if the client collects oversized art books or vintage atlases. A tree bookshelf with 6-inch-deep shelves looks sleek in photos, but in practice it only works for paperbacks, and if you try to load it with hardcovers, the books will overhang the front edge and the whole installation looks precarious. I've had clients ask me to design custom shelving with graduated depths—8 inches on the upper tiers for paperbacks, 10 inches on the lower tiers for hardcovers—and that approach works beautifully if you're willing to pay for custom fabrication, but for off-the-shelf units, a consistent 9-inch depth is the safest bet.
Explore Reading Chairs & Recliners →The fourth detail is how the unit handles uneven floors, which matter more than you'd think in pre-war apartments where the floor can slope a quarter-inch over 6 feet. A bookshelf with a rigid base will rock on an uneven floor, and once it starts rocking, the movement will loosen the shelf attachments and accelerate wear. I look for units with adjustable feet or leveling glides that let you compensate for floor slope without shimming, and I avoid designs with a single central post that can't be leveled independently at each corner. In a Beacon Hill walk-up I worked on in 2026, the floor sloped toward the window and the client's ladder bookshelf rocked every time she pulled a book from the top shelf—we added adjustable furniture glides to the base and the rocking stopped immediately, but it was a detail the manufacturer should have included from the start.
The fifth and final detail is finish durability, which becomes critical in small spaces because you're close enough to the bookshelf to see every scratch and ding. I avoid painted finishes on metal bookshelves unless the paint is powder-coated, because standard spray paint will chip within the first year and the chips become rust spots if you're in a humid climate or near a radiator. For wood units, I prefer oil-rubbed or natural finishes over stain, because stain shows wear more visibly and you can't touch it up without refinishing the entire piece. A client in Greenwich bought a black-stained ladder shelf in 2018, and within two years the edges where she gripped the shelves to move books had worn through to bare wood—we ended up sanding the whole unit and applying a clear matte polyurethane, but it was a weekend project she shouldn't have needed to do on a piece of furniture that cost three hundred dollars.
Why I stopped trusting floating shelves rated below 25 pounds per bracket
The math on floating shelf capacity is straightforward: a hardcover book weighs 1.5 to 2 pounds, a 36-inch shelf holds roughly 20 books in a single row, and that adds up to 30 to 40 pounds of load before you account for the weight of the shelf itself. If the bracket is rated for 15 pounds and you install two brackets per shelf, you're theoretically at 30 pounds of capacity—but that rating assumes the bracket is anchored into a stud, the load is evenly distributed, and the shelf material doesn't sag under point loads. In practice, none of those assumptions hold. The bracket is often anchored into drywall with a toggle bolt that compresses the gypsum over time, the books cluster toward the center of the shelf where you can reach them easily, and particle-board shelves sag under concentrated weight even if the brackets hold. I've watched three clients install floating shelves rated for 15 to 20 pounds per bracket, and in every case the shelves developed a visible sag within the first year.
The second problem with floating brackets is that they create a cantilever load on the wall, and if the wall is lath-and-plaster instead of modern drywall, the plaster will crack around the anchor point as the bracket flexes under load. I designed a library in a 1920s brownstone in 2018 where the client insisted on floating shelves for her poetry collection, and within six months we had hairline cracks radiating from every bracket—we patched the cracks, removed the floating shelves, and installed a freestanding ladder unit that didn't stress the plaster at all. The lesson is that floating shelves work beautifully in new construction with studs every 16 inches and half-inch drywall, but in pre-war buildings with irregular framing and fragile plaster, they're a recipe for cosmetic damage that costs more to repair than the shelves cost to install.
The third issue is that floating brackets rated below 25 pounds per bracket are almost always made from thin-gauge steel that flexes under load, and once the bracket flexes, the shelf develops a permanent bow that you can't correct without replacing the bracket. I've seen brackets rated for 20 pounds that were stamped from 16-gauge steel, and they flexed visibly when I loaded them with just 15 pounds of books during a test installation. I now specify brackets made from quarter-inch steel plate or solid cast iron, and I insist on a minimum rating of 25 pounds per bracket even if the client plans to store lightweight paperbacks—because the rating is the floor, not the ceiling, and you want headroom for the day she decides to move her hardcover collection onto the same shelf.
The fourth consideration is bracket depth, which needs to match the shelf depth or you'll have an overhang that creates a tipping moment. A 10-inch shelf on an 8-inch bracket will tilt forward under load, and the tilt gets worse as you add books because the center of gravity moves farther from the wall. I specify brackets that extend to within an inch of the front edge of the shelf, and I avoid designs where the bracket is decorative rather than structural—scrollwork and ornamental curves look lovely, but they don't add stiffness, and stiffness is what prevents sag. If the bracket has a visible weld seam or a bolted joint, I check that the weld is continuous and the bolts are through-bolted rather than tapped into thin metal, because a failed weld or a stripped thread will drop the entire shelf without warning.
The fifth and final detail is how the bracket attaches to the shelf itself. Some floating brackets use a concealed rod that slides into a hole drilled in the back of the shelf, and if the hole is drilled off-center or the rod diameter is too small, the shelf will wobble or twist under load. I prefer brackets that attach to the underside of the shelf with screws or bolts, because the attachment is visible and verifiable and you can tighten it if it loosens over time. A concealed-rod bracket looks cleaner, but if it fails, you have to remove the entire shelf to diagnose the problem, and in a small space where the shelf is wedged between a radiator and a window frame, that's an hour of furniture-moving you don't want to repeat.
The clearance you actually need behind a corner bookshelf
When I measure a corner for a bookshelf installation, I check three dimensions: the baseboard projection, the corner squareness, and the distance from the corner to the nearest obstruction like a radiator or outlet. In pre-war apartments, baseboards often project 2 to 3 inches from the wall, and if the bookshelf sits on top of the baseboard, the entire unit will be offset from the wall by that same distance—which means a corner unit that's supposed to fit flush will actually leave a triangular gap behind it that collects dust and makes the installation look unfinished. I've measured corners in Beacon Hill walk-ups where the baseboard projection varied by half an inch from one wall to the other, and a rigid corner bookshelf couldn't sit flush against both walls simultaneously—we ended up using a freestanding tree bookshelf positioned parallel to one wall instead, and the client gained back the floor space she would have lost to the gap.
The second clearance issue is corner squareness, which is almost never exactly 90 degrees in older buildings. I use a framing square to check the corner angle, and if it's off by more than 2 degrees, a corner bookshelf will either bind against one wall or leave a gap on the other. I've seen corners that measured 88 degrees and corners that measured 93 degrees, and in both cases a corner-specific design failed to fit properly. The solution is to choose a unit with adjustable side panels or to skip the corner entirely and use a narrow ladder shelf that sits against one wall and doesn't depend on the corner geometry. It's less visually dramatic than a corner unit, but it's also less likely to require custom shimming or on-site carpentry to make it work.
The third clearance consideration is the distance from the corner to the radiator, which in most pre-war apartments is positioned under the window and extends 6 to 8 inches from the wall. If you position a corner bookshelf in the same corner as the radiator, you'll either block the heat output or leave a gap wide enough to lose books behind the unit. I've had clients insist on corner placement because it looked efficient on the floor plan, and then we discovered the radiator clearance required moving the bookshelf 10 inches away from the corner, which defeated the entire purpose of the corner design. A freestanding unit positioned against the wall opposite the radiator solves the problem completely, and if you choose an open-back design, the heat from the radiator can circulate through the shelves instead of being trapped behind a solid panel.
The difference between particle board and Baltic birch when humidity fluctuates
Particle board is compressed wood fibers held together with resin, and when the humidity rises above 60 percent, the resin softens and the fibers swell—when the humidity drops back down, the fibers don't return to their original size, and the board develops a permanent warp. I've seen particle-board shelves in Manhattan apartments swell by a quarter-inch over a single summer, and once the swelling starts, the shelf edges delaminate and the surface develops a rough texture that snags book covers. Baltic birch plywood, by contrast, is made from thin veneers of birch glued in alternating grain directions, and the cross-grain construction resists warping even when the humidity swings from 30 percent in winter to 70 percent in summer. I specify Baltic birch for any shelf longer than 24 inches or any installation near a radiator or window where humidity will fluctuate, and I've never had a Baltic birch shelf warp or delaminate in fifteen years of specifying it.
Explore Side Tables & Tray Tables →The second difference is edge durability, which matters because the edges of a bookshelf are where your hands make contact every time you pull a book. Particle board edges are fragile and will chip if you bump them with a hardcover spine, and once the edge chips, the exposed particle core absorbs moisture and swells into a rough, ugly bulge. Baltic birch edges, by contrast, are solid wood plies that you can sand smooth if they get dinged, and the edge grain is attractive enough that you don't need edge banding or veneer to make it look finished. I've installed particle-board shelves with PVC edge banding that peeled off within two years, and I've installed Baltic birch shelves with raw edges that still look clean after a decade of use—the difference in edge durability alone justifies the extra cost of the better material.
The third consideration is screw-holding strength, which determines whether the shelf stays attached to the uprights over time. Particle board compresses around screw threads, and if you tighten the screw too much, it strips the hole and loses holding power—if you don't tighten it enough, the screw works loose as the shelf flexes under load. Baltic birch holds screws tightly because the cross-grain plies distribute the clamping force in multiple directions, and you can remove and reinstall screws multiple times without stripping the hole. I've disassembled and reassembled Baltic birch bookshelves during apartment moves, and the screw holes were still tight after the third reinstallation—try that with particle board and you'll be filling the holes with wood glue and toothpicks by the second move. Why open-back designs work better in small spaces than enclosed units
An open-back bookshelf allows light to pass through the unit, which makes a small room feel larger because the wall behind the shelf remains visible and the shelf doesn't create a visual barrier. I've installed open-back ladder shelves in studios where the client was worried about blocking the window light, and the open design let enough light through that we didn't need to add a floor lamp in the reading corner. An enclosed bookshelf with a solid back, by contrast, blocks light and makes the wall disappear, which in a 10-foot by 12-foot room can make the space feel 20 percent smaller because you've lost one of the four walls to a piece of furniture. The difference is subtle in a large room, but in a small space it's the gap between cozy and claustrophobic. (see also: Best Recliner for Reading: Your Cozy Reading Nook Guide 2026)
The second advantage of an open back is that it doesn't trap heat from radiators, which in pre-war apartments are almost always positioned under windows. If you place a solid-back bookshelf in front of a radiator, the heat rises behind the unit and can't circulate into the room, which wastes energy and can damage the books on the lower shelves by exposing them to dry heat. An open-back design lets the heat flow through the shelves and into the room, and if you position the unit a few inches away from the radiator, the rising heat actually helps prevent moisture buildup on the books. I've had clients report that their heating bills dropped after we replaced a solid-back unit with an open ladder shelf, and while I can't quantify the savings, the improved heat circulation was noticeable enough that they mentioned it without prompting.
The third benefit is that an open back weighs less than a solid panel, which matters if you're anchoring the unit to a wall or moving it during cleaning. A 6-foot ladder shelf with an open back weighs 30 to 40 pounds, while the same unit with a quarter-inch plywood back weighs 50 to 60 pounds—that extra 20 pounds makes the difference between a one-person move and a two-person move, and it also increases the load on any wall anchors if you're securing the top of the unit for tip-over prevention. In a Manhattan studio where the client wanted to rearrange her furniture seasonally, the open-back design let her move the bookshelf by herself without risking a back injury or scratching the floor.

What are the most critical considerations when selecting the best bookshelves for small spaces, beyond just aesthetics?
Beyond visual appeal, prioritize structural integrity and depth. Many wall-mounted options, especially those with thinner particleboard, can sag within eighteen months under the weight of substantial hardcovers. Ensure the depth is appropriate for your book sizes without encroaching excessively on your usable floor space.
I have a pre-war apartment with radiators; will typical corner bookshelf designs actually work for my reading nook?
Corner bookshelf designs often prove problematic in pre-war apartments, particularly those with immovable radiators. The irregular angles and placement of these architectural features can make a snug fit impossible, leaving awkward gaps or preventing the unit from sitting flush against the walls.
Are there specific types of wall-mounted bookshelves that are less prone to sagging in small spaces?
Look for wall-mounted bookshelves constructed from solid wood or high-quality MDF with reinforced backing. Systems that utilize robust French cleat mounting or have integrated, substantial shelf supports are far less likely to sag than those with simple peg systems or flimsy hardware.
